The Wahoo ELEMNT Bolt V2 is a feature-rich GPS bike computer designed for serious cyclists. One of its standout features is the on-device turn-by-turn navigation, which is highly useful for those who frequently explore new routes. The device supports various file types and integrates well with popular apps like Strava, Ride With GPS, and Komoot. Additionally, the ANT+ radar integration enhances safety by alerting you to approaching vehicles, a great feature for those riding in busy areas.
The training features, including integration with TrainerRoad and TrainingPeaks, make it an excellent tool for athletes aiming to optimize their workouts. The automatic route downloads and workout uploads save time and simplify data management. The 2.2-inch color screen is clear and easy to read, and the customizable quicklook LED indicators offer at-a-glance information. However, the 15-hour battery life may be limiting for ultra-long rides or bikepacking trips. Mounting is straightforward, and the device is durable, featuring a Gorilla Glass lens.
For connectivity, it supports a wide range of technologies including GPS, GLONASS, and Bluetooth, making it versatile for various smartphone integrations. The smart notifications and live tracking enhance its usability, although they require a paired smartphone. The plethora of features and integrations are appealing, they might be overkill for casual riders. The Wahoo ELEMNT Bolt V2 is best suited for dedicated cyclists who need advanced navigation, training, and safety features.
The Bryton Rider S800 is a high-end bicycle odometer featuring a 3.4-inch color touchscreen with excellent visibility in various lighting conditions. Its user-friendly interface and automatic backlight adjustment contribute to an enhanced user experience. The standout feature is the impressive 36-hour battery life, making it suitable for long-distance cycling without frequent recharging concerns. The seamless recording feature ensures no data loss, even if the device powers off temporarily.
Navigation is robust, with global GPS coverage, pre-loaded maps, turn-by-turn navigation, and rerouting capabilities. The Climb Challenge and indoor smart trainer compatibility add significant value, especially for those who love detailed ride analyses and effective indoor training sessions. Safety is also addressed with bike radar compatibility, providing alerts for approaching vehicles.
Connectivity options are extensive, supporting Bluetooth and ANT+ to connect with various sensors and electronic shifting systems, ensuring real-time data monitoring. It also integrates well with popular third-party platforms like Strava and TrainingPeaks through the Bryton Active App. However, some potential downsides include the complexity of setup for non-tech-savvy users and the relatively high price point. The device is IPX7 rated for water resistance, making it durable for different weather conditions. Despite its numerous advanced features, the Bryton Rider S800 is best suited for serious cyclists who desire comprehensive data tracking and robust navigation capabilities.
